SP PNG Hunters down Wynnum Manly Seagulls 36 - 22

 The SP PNG Hunters have produced an inspired 36-22 win over last year’s grand finalists Wynnum Manly Seagulls in Round 14 of the QRL Hostplus Cup.  In picturesque conditions at BMD Kougari Oval on Saturday afternoon, the Hunters embraced the lively Wynnum crowd and their intent was evident from the kick-off. The PNG side worked into attacking field position confidently with just their second possession and looked dangerous with the ball until some resolute Seagulls’ defence forced the first error of the match. SP PNG Hunters Media  Marching upfield themselves in response, it was Wynnum Manly who would go on the attack next. They looked to have scored courtesy of a smooth right edge shift only for Hunters’ backrower Kitron Laka to appear out of nowhere in cover and knock the ball loose over the line, saving a certain try.   Discipline was the telling difference between this Hunters’ side and the one that lost to Ipswich last week. PNG Deputy Prime Minister John Rosso retains Lae Open Seat

Papua New Guinea Deputy Prime Minister and Lae MP John Rosso has been declared on first preferential votes this evening scoring almost 27 thousand votes. Rosso collected 26,864 primary votes reaching 50 per-cent plus one or  absolute majority of the total votes. The votes were received across Lae city from 65 wards. He thanked the people of Lae for showing the confidence and returning him overwhelmingly in his victory speech at the Sir Ignatius Kilage stadium. “Bikpla thank you tru long ol pipol blong Lae disla absolute majority yupela sowim, me tok thank you and I stand very humble before all you peers. Me no stretpela man me wankain olsem yupela tasol I will do my best to ensure that Lae rightfully deserves its place as the second largest city of PNG.” Rosso further condemned election related violence in Markham and Kabuwm district which saw ballot boxes and papers destroyed.  ” Yupela bakarapim ol box na bakarapim democratic process ya me condemim. Lelang is New PNG Opposition Leader

Member for Kandrian Gloucester Joseph Lelang is the new Opposition leader of the Papua New Guinea Parliament. The announcement was made this morning during a media conference by the People’s National Congress Party. Mr. Lelang says they will keep the government in check and balance on national issues. Member for Kiriwina/Goodenough Douglas Tomuriesa is the Deputy Opposition leader. The announcements were made by the leader of the PNC Party Peter O’Neill. Nameri National Park: Assam’s Wildlife Haven

It is the most scenic of all national parks in Assam. It is a paradise for birdwatchers and it is teeming with bio diversity. I am talking about the lush green Nameri National Park that overlooks the Eastern Himalayas in the background and has the lively Jia Bhoroli river criss-crossing the national park. Historically popular with anglers, today, Nameri is popular with wildlife researchers and enthusiasts. It is home to over 600 floral species including rudrakhsa and rare orchids. Close to 400 bird species have been recorded here including the Great Pied Hornbill, white winged wood duck, rufus necked hornbill, black stork, ibis bill and more. And in terms of mammals, Nameri national park provides habitat for Asian elephant, royal bengal tiger, Indian leopard, clouded leopard, marbled cat, gaur, barking deer, dhole, Himalayan black bear, capped langur, Malayan giant squirrel, wild boar, slow loris and many more.
